Working with Clients with Diminished Capacity: Practice Considerations with Caitlin Palencia of Disability Rights New Mexico (DRNM).
Caitlin Palencia is a Staff Attorney at Disability Rights New Mexico (DRNM), the designated Protection and Advocacy system for our state, which provides legal and advocacy services to protect the rights of people with disabilities. Before joining DRNM in 2023, Caitlin was a Staff Attorney for the NM Office of Guardianship at the Developmental Disabilities Council, and an Assistant District Attorney in the Bernalillo County, where she was assigned to the Competency Court and Behavioral Health Specialty Court. Caitlin’s volunteer experience includes prior service on the Protection and Advocacy for Individuals with Mental Illness Advisory Council, and on the National Alliance on Mental Illness, New Mexico board. At DRNM, Caitlin does systemic and individual case work in a variety of disability rights matters, with an emphasis on work around probate guardianships, a serious, and prevalent issue for adults with disabilities, including aging adults who may be experiencing diminished capacity. Caitlin’s work in this area focuses on helping individuals understand, identify, and implement less restrictive alternatives to guardianship like setting up advanced directives, use of a power of attorney, and engaging in other future planning to address individuals’ specific needs with their financial, medical, and property matters.
